Abstract
OBJECTIVE: The quality and rationality of many recently registered clinical studies related to co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) needs to be assessed. Hence, this study aims to evaluate the current status of COVID-19 related registered clinical trial.Entities:

Interventional clinical studies for COVID-19.
| Interventions | Trials Number | Percentage |
|---|---|---|
| Total | 943 | 100% |
| Hydroxychloroquine | 157 | 16.6% |
| Hydroxychloroquine & Azithromycin | 51 | 5.4% |
| Chloroquine | 22 | 2.3% |
| Remdesivir | 10 | 1.1% |
| Lopinavir/Ritonavir | 32 | 3.4% |
| Favipiravir | 16 | 1.7% |
| Interferon | 23 | 2.4% |
| Glucocorticoid | 29 | 3.1% |
| Immunity therapy | 53 | 5.6% |
| Targeted Therapy | 23 | 2.4% |
| Convalescent plasma | 66 | 7.0% |
| Dietary Supplement | 18 | 1.9% |
| Device | 63 | 6.7% |
| Behavioral | 47 | 5.0% |
| Other | 333 | 35.3% |
